Tucson and related destinations
Surrounded by saguaro cacti, this desert city offers stunning hikes in Sabino Canyon and the chance to explore Sonoran cuisine. Visit the historic Mission San Xavier del Bac and stroll through the Arizona-Sonora Desert Museum when temperatures cool in late afternoon.

What's the difference between 5-star and 4-star hotels in Tucson?
Treat yourself to refined living during your Tucson getaway by checking in to a 4-star hotel. As well as featuring upscale surroundings, these retreats are usually filled with amenities like large beds, complimentary bathrobes and plenty more. A 5-star hotel will go the extra mile to make your trip an even more lavish and unforgettable one. Concierge assistance, on-site spas and gourmet dining are just the start of the superior services and conveniences you'll likely be able to enjoy.
